It shouldn't either, integrated LUFS measurement is meant for longer parts/whole songs. Short term LUFS should give the level of last 3 seconds and Momentary LUFS last 400 ms.

In the latest +dev0614 build, LUFS-I should be displayed after 400ms of audio has been processed, like LUFS-M. LUFS-S will be displayed after 3000ms, and LRA after... a while (3000ms plus at least 2000ms of non-silent material).
